William Rankine, a designer and physicist, developed a different to Coulomb's earth pressure theory. Albert Atterberg created the clay consistency indices that are still used today for dirt classification. In 1885, Osborne Reynolds identified that shearing causes volumetric dilation of thick materials and contraction of loose granular materials. Modern geotechnical design is stated to have actually begun in 1925 with the publication of Erdbaumechanik by Karl von Terzaghi, a mechanical designer and rock hound.

Terzaghi also created the framework for theories of bearing ability of structures, and the theory for prediction of the price of settlement of clay layers because of loan consolidation. After that, Maurice Biot completely developed the three-dimensional soil debt consolidation concept, expanding the one-dimensional design previously created by Terzaghi to extra general theories and presenting the set of fundamental formulas of Poroelasticity.

Geotechnical designers can assess and improve slope security utilizing design techniques. A formerly steady incline might be initially affected by numerous variables, making it unpredictable. Geotechnical designers can create and execute crafted slopes to raise security.


Generally, the user interface's exact geometry is unidentified, and a simplified interface geometry is assumed. Finite slopes call for three-dimensional versions to be analyzed, so most slopes are analyzed thinking that they are infinitely wide and can be represented by two-dimensional versions.

The empirical technique may be called follows: General expedition adequate to establish the rough nature, pattern, and residential or commercial properties of deposits. Assessment of one of the most possible conditions and one of the most undesirable imaginable deviations. Creating the style based upon a functioning theory of actions anticipated under the most possible conditions. Option of quantities to be observed as building and construction proceeds and determining their prepared for worths based upon the working theory under the most negative problems.


Dimension of quantities and examination of real conditions. Design adjustment per actual conditions The empirical method appropriates site here for building and construction that has actually currently started when an unanticipated development happens or when a failing or mishap looms or has currently occurred. Geotechnical design is a part of civil engineering that concentrates on exactly how earth products like dirt, rock and groundwater engage with man-made structures, such as buildings, bridges, dams and roads. The objective is to make sure that the subsurface - the geology underneath any building - can sustaining whatever is built on top.
